In this post I will list the known issues or possible improvements for Lemmy.world. Please comment with any issue or area for improvement you see and I will add it here. Issues can be: - Local (lemmy.world) (also performance issues) - Lemmy software issues - Other software related (apps/Fediverse platforms etc) - Remote server related - (User error? …) ## Known issues - Federation issue: local lemmy.world account’s posts not showing when following from a remote server Mastodon/Calckey/Alloma. - Post / Reply takes 2 to 5 seconds ## Enhancement requests - Can themes be added? > To be checked if this can be done without changing code.

Certain communities seem to be inaccessible from Lemmy.world and vice versa. For instance, if I try to access /c/boston in Lemmy.ml via lemmy.world/c/[email protected], I get a "404: couldnt_find_community" error. Similarly, trying to access /c/boston in Lemmy.world from either Kbin.social (via kbin.social/m/[email protected]) or Lemmy.ml (via lemmy.ml/c/[email protected]) both give 404 errors.
I've observed the same thing, newer lemmy.ml communities and pretty much everything from kbin returns 404 when accessed through this instance. It happens with other instances, to a varying degree.
Strange! Does that possibly mean there’s an issue with federation on the lemmy.world side?
